Category / Metric Pittsburgh New Orleans
Financial Overview
Median Income $66,219 $55,580
Unemployment Rate 4% 4%
Housing Market
Median Home Price $275,000 $322,500
Price per SqFt $171 $185
Monthly Rent (1BR) $965 $1,149
Housing Cost Index 73.5 79.7
Cost of Living
Groceries Index 98.5 92.0
Gas Price (Gallon) $3.40 $3.40
Safety & Lifestyle
Violent Crime (per 100k) 567.0 1234.0
Bachelor's Degree+ 51% 45%
Air Quality (AQI) 45 38
